Bricks Through the Ages: Architectural Evolution

From humble beginnings to sophisticated structures, bricks have been an integral part of human civilization for millennia. Early civilizations in Mesopotamia and Egypt employed bricks as building materials, crafting strong dwellings and monumental temples.

Roman architects mastered the art of bricklaying, incorporating it into their grand aqueducts, amphitheaters, and bathhouses. The Romans' innovative use of arches and vaults, combined with their mastery of bricklaying techniques, created some of the most enduring architectural feats in history.

Throughout the Middle Ages, bricks continued to be a popular choice for construction. Gothic cathedrals, with their soaring arches, were often adorned with intricate brickwork. In the Renaissance and Baroque periods, architects experimented with new shapes and designs, creating elaborate facades and intricate brick patterns.

The Industrial Revolution marked the start of a new era for bricks. Mass production techniques resulted in an increase in availability and affordability, making bricks accessible to a wider range of builders. Modern architecture has embraced modern brick designs, incorporating them into everything from minimalist homes to towering skyscrapers.

Bricks have come a long way since their early starts. Contemporary bricks are a testament to the enduring legacy of this versatile building material.

Sustainable Building Practices: The Case for Bricks masonry

In the ever-increasing emphasis on sustainable construction practices, building here materials are coming under intense scrutiny. While traditional options like concrete and steel have dominated for decades, a compelling case can be made for the enduring solidity of bricks as a sustainable choice. Bricks boast an impressive lifespan, often outlasting generations, thereby minimizing the requirement for frequent replacements and associated waste generation. Furthermore, the production process of soil bricks is inherently energy-efficient compared to their counterparts.

  • Moreover, brick manufacturing utilizes readily available resources, often sourced locally, which minimizes transportation costs and carbon emissions.
  • The inherent heat-regulating properties of bricks contribute to energy savings in buildings, lowering heating and cooling expenditures.

Adopting brick construction not only benefits the environment but also offers architectural versatility, allowing for a wide range of design styles and aesthetics.
